The poster explains emergency care for conscious and unconscious choking victims. It has a place to list an emergency phone number.
While it must be posted in every food service facility, it could help if your employees eat on the premises.
The Chicago Illinois Emergency Care for Choking Poster is a visual guide produced by the Chicago Department of Public Health (CDP) to educate individuals on how to respond to choking emergencies quickly and effectively. This poster aims to provide step-by-step instructions and key information to the public, ensuring that anyone who comes across a choking victim can provide immediate aid to potentially save a life. The poster typically features a clear and concise layout, with bold headings and bright colors, making it easily noticeable in various locations such as restaurants, schools, community centers, workplaces, and public areas throughout Chicago and its surrounding areas. The CDP may also update and release different versions of the poster periodically to ensure that the information remains current and reflects the latest guidelines for emergency care. The content of the Chicago Illinois Emergency Care for Choking Poster includes significant keywords to grab attention and convey crucial actions to perform during a choking incident. These keywords may include "Emergency Care," "Choking," "First Aid," "Heimlich Maneuver," and "Life-saving Techniques," among others. The poster may also present the following elements: 1. Clear illustrations: The poster often includes visual representations or pictograms to demonstrate the correct techniques and postures for providing assistance during a choking episode. These drawings may feature both adult and child victims to address diverse age groups. 2. The Heimlich Maneuver: Emphasizing the widely known Heimlich Maneuver, the poster illustrates the correct hand placement and procedure for performing abdominal thrusts on a choking individual of varying ages. 3. Emergency contact information: The poster may provide local emergency contact information, including the universal emergency number 911, to ensure that individuals are aware of whom to call for immediate professional assistance. 4. Additional guidelines: The poster may offer supplementary information, such as signs of complete airway obstruction, signs of partial airway obstruction, and instructions on how to perform back blows and chest thrusts for infants less than one year old. 5. Bilingual options: To cater to Chicago's diverse population, the poster may be available in multiple languages, such as English and Spanish, to reach a broader audience and ensure comprehension among non-English speakers. In summary, the Chicago Illinois Emergency Care for Choking Poster serves as an informative tool designed to promote public safety and educate the public on prompt and appropriate actions to take during choking emergencies. Its primary goal is to equip individuals with the necessary knowledge and skills to effectively respond to choking incidents, potentially preventing severe harm or loss of life.
